- Backblaze published Q1 2026 cloud storage performance stats, flagging wide regional dispersion that undermines single-vendor cloud storage strategies.
- Testing across US-East, EU-Central showed no provider led consistently across geographies or workloads, challenging default reliance on AWS.
- US-East results improved quarter over quarter on average upload and download times across most providers.
- EU-Central rankings diverged from US-East, with Cloudflare R2 strong on average upload and download times.
- Sustained throughput results differed from averages, with multi-threaded tests showing the widest gaps between top and bottom performers.
